Re: And the CEO ?
That was a great meeting last Saturday. At least 12 people were there.
It didn't begin so well as the meeting place was locked and nobody was there to open us.
We lost one hour but thanks to Jede (and Coco.oric's credit card) we were able to quickly rent another meeting room, which was well equiped.
Jede demoed us his new usb/SD card reader (see http://forum.defence-force.org/viewtopic.php?f=9&t=1711).
Kenneth show his SD card reader project (see http://forums.oric.org/t189-rs - in French).
We showed Chema's Balke's 7 work in progress (see http://forum.defence-force.org/viewtopi ... =20&t=1273), running from a Cumulus !
Having forgotten my software at home, I wanted to show the very fast tape routines but was only able to show the video I made on Youtube a few months ago.
And lots of discussons, generous gifts from Marc and Jean (tapes, Atmos keyboard...), and so on.
This is Blake's 7, you can see the Cumulus at the bottom of the picture.
